中国银行申请SQL专利,实现将原始类型的第一SQL语句自动转换为目标...
本申请的方法,使用原始类型对应的分割符号集,对待转换的原始类型的第一SQL语句进行分割,得到第一SQL语句的内容片段;在原始类型对应的关键命令集中,查找第一SQL语句的内容片段匹配到的关键命令,调用匹配到的关键命令对应的转换程序,通过执行对应的转换程序,将第一SQL语句转换为具有相同功能的目标类型的第二SQL语句;输出目...
手把手教您如何进行数据质量管理
在第2层移动数据时,无论是通过ETL、ESB、点对点集成等,都需要保持数据在移动和/或转换过程中的完整性。第2层(数据引入层)用于出于以下两个主要目的之一移动数据:将数据从原始系统移动到下游系统以支持集成的业务流程。将数据移动到数据所在的第3层,用于其他目的。这种最纯粹形式的数据移动意味着我们将原始数据移...
新书速览|MySQL 8.0从入门到实战
第1部分(第1~3章)介绍MySQL的基础知识,包括初识MySQL、数据库设计和数据类型;第2部分(第4~6章)介绍MySQL的基本操作,包括SQL基础操作、MySQL连接查询和数据复制、MySQL基础函数;第3部分(第7、8章)介绍MySQL高级查询函数,包括MySQL高级函数和窗口函数;第4部分(第9、10章)介绍MySQL数据表分区,包括MySQL...
SQL Server自动生成日期加数字的序列号
SET@NUM=CONVERT(VARCHAR,(CONVERT(INT,RIGHT(@NEW_ID,8))+1))--因为经过类型转换,丢失了高位的0,需要补上SET@NUM=REPLICATE('0',8-LEN(@NUM))+@NUM--最后返回日期加编号SET@NEW_ID=@YYYY+@MM+@DD+@NUMENDENDGO--执行20次调用及插入数据测试DECLARE@...
GaussDB数据类型转换介绍
日期转换:GaussDB支持将日期类型转换为其他日期类型,例如将日期转换为时间类型、将时间类型转换为日期类型等。布尔型转换:GaussDB支持将布尔型数据转换为其他数据类型,例如将布尔型转换为整型、将布尔型转换为字符串类型等。需要注意的是,在进行数据类型转换时,应该考虑出现的数据精度、数据溢出、数据失真等问题,同时也...
MySQL 避坑指南之隐式数据类型转换
如果一个参数是TIMESTAMP或者DATETIME字段,另一个参数是常量,该常量将会在比较之前转换为时间戳类型(www.e993.com)2024年7月27日。这一规则是为了更好地支持ODBC规范。IN()运算符中的参数不会执行这一转换。为了保险起见,记得在执行比较运算时使用完整的日期时间、日期或者时间字符串。例如,在使用BTWEEN运算符判断日期或者时间数据时...
慢sql治理经典案例分享
4、需要类型转换;5、where中索引列有运算;6、where中索引列使用了函数;7、如果mysql觉得全表扫描更快时(数据少时)上述查询语句第8行,customer_id为XXX_level_report表字段,未命中XXX_white_list表索引,导致索引失效。3解决方案这个语句用condition、枚举、join花里胡哨的代码拼接起来的,改起来好麻烦,而且...
SQL无法走索引的情况及解决思路
SQL无法走索引常见的有如下8种情况:1.统计信息不准确2.索引列的值允许为NULL3.谓词使用了不等于(<>,!=)4.LIKE前通配或全通配的查询5.索引列使用了函数、数学运算、其它表达式等6.使用了隐式类型转换7.查询转换失败8.其它语句逻辑原因...
几个实用SQL操作小技巧
这个对一些调试SQL代码的非常有用,因为SQL报错都会提示你报错的位置在第几行,显示行号就可以快速锁定位置。要显示行号还是在上面的选项对话框中配置,具体如下:选中行号即可显示代码行数。4、字符串与日期类型转换字符串和日期类型一般都可以相互转换,主要是使用CONVERT()函数来进行转换。
StarRocks技术内幕:查询原理浅析|sql|算法|优化器|算子_网易订阅
4.函数参数的合法性检测:Sum的参数类型必须是数值类型,Lead和Lag窗口函数第2和第3个参数必须常量等5.类型检查和类型转换:BIGINT和DECIMAL比较,BIGINT类型需要Cast成DECIMALSQLAnalyze的结果是一个有层级结构的Relation,如图2所示,比如一个From子句对应一个TableRelation,一个...